MOLDING SUBSTRATE
The present invention relates to a molding substrate capable of realizing an exterior material for a vehicle from which the attached snow or ice is more easily peeled off. As a result of continuing studies by the applicant of the present application, it has been found that the problem that the adhered snow and ice hardly peels off, which occurs on a molding base material provided with a fiber base layer containing a core-sheath type conjugate fiber in which the sheath portion is a polypropylene-based resin and the core portion is a polyester-based resin, can be solved by adjusting the mass percentage of the core-sheath type conjugate fiber occupying the fiber constituting the fiber base material layer. Specifically, the present inventors have provided a molding substrate which can realize an exterior material such as an exterior material for a vehicle from which adhered snow or ice is easily peeled off, by being a molding substrate having a fiber base layer having a mass percentage of more than 70% by mass.
METHOD AND SYSTEM FOR PRODUCING A REINFORCING BAR, AND RESULTING REINFORCING BAR
A method for producing a reinforcing bar by pultrusion, the method comprising the steps of: a) providing a source of fibres; b) assembling the fibres into a bundle; c) impregnating the bundle with a thermosetting resin; d) eliminating excess resin from the bundle; e) compressing the bundle in a centripetal manner; f) exposing the bundle to a radiant energy source; g) spraying particles onto a surface of the bundle; and h) exposing the bundle to radiation in order to initiate, on the surface of same, the polymerisation of the resin. The present invention also concerns a system provided with corresponding devices in order to be able to implement the method. The present invention also concerns a reinforcing bar obtained with the described method and/or system.

MULTILAYER STRUCTURE FOR TRANSPORTING OR STORING HYDROGEN
A multilayer structure selected from a reservoir, a pipe or a tube, for transporting, distributing or storing hydrogen, including, from the inside to the outside, at least one sealing layer and at least one composite reinforcing layer, the innermost composite reinforcing layer being welded to the outermost adjacent sealing layer, the sealing layers including at least one semi-crystalline thermoplastic polymer, the Tm of which is less than 280° C., wherein the at least one thermoplastic polymer of each sealing layer may be the same or different, and at least one of the composite reinforcing layers being of a fibrous material in the form of continuous fibers impregnated with a composition of at least one thermoplastic polymer P2j, the thermoplastic polymer P2j having a Tg greater than the maximum temperature of use of said structure (Tu), with Tg≥Tu+20° C., Tu being greater than 50° C.
Methods for forming footwear using recycled plastics
Presented are manufacturing systems, methods, and devices for forming footwear using scrap or waste plastic materials. A method for manufacturing an article of footwear, such as an athletic shoe, begins with receiving a batch of recycled plastic, which may include thermoplastic elastomers or ethylene-vinyl acetate, and grinding the batch of recycled plastic material. The ground recycled material is processed, for example, by adding a foaming agent that activates at elevated temperatures. The processed recycled material is placed into the internal cavity of a final mold that is shaped like a segment of the footwear, such as a unitary sole structure. To form the footwear segment, the processed recycled material is heated past the threshold activation temperature of the foaming agent such that the foaming agent causes the recycled material to expand and fill the internal cavity of the final mold. The formed footwear segment is then extracted from the mold.

Composite structures and methods for manufacturing composite structures
A method for manufacturing a composite structure. The method includes depositing a plurality of thermoplastic particles onto at least one of a surface of a filler member and a surface of a structural member. The method further includes assembling the filler member with the structural member such that the plurality of thermoplastic particles are disposed proximate an interface between the filler member and the structural member.
